As each season brings its own unique charm and character, so too can your home décor reflect these changes. One of the most impactful ways to give your living space a seasonal facelift is through the use of drapery. The right curtains or drapes not only enhance the aesthetics of your room but also improve functionality by controlling light, temperature, and privacy. Here are some creative ideas for seasonal drapery that will help you refresh your home throughout the year.
Spring: Embrace Freshness and Lightness
Spring is synonymous with renewal and rejuvenation. It’s the perfect time to inject life and color back into your home after the long winter months.
Fabric Choices
Opt for light fabrics such as cotton, linen, or sheer materials that allow sunlight to filter in, creating a bright and airy atmosphere. Floral patterns or pastel colors can elevate the spring vibe, making your space feel vibrant.
Color Palette
Consider soft greens, yellows, or blush pinks to mimic the blooming flora outside. You could also choose drapes with botanical prints that echo the natural surroundings.
Layering Techniques
To celebrate the season’s warmth, consider layering sheer panels over thicker drapes. This allows you to control light levels while creating dimension in your window treatments. For example, a sheer white curtain layered over a soft green linen can create an ethereal look that feels both refreshing and sophisticated.
Summer: Light and Breezy Aesthetics
Summer calls for lightness not just in clothing but also in home décor. This is when you want to invite as much natural light into your space as possible while keeping it cool.
Fabric Choices
Materials such as sheer voile or lightweight cotton are ideal for summer drapes. They provide privacy while still allowing ample sunlight to brighten your rooms.
Color Palette
Brighten up your space with vibrant colors like turquoise, sunny yellow, or coral. Nautical themes can also be brought in with navy blue stripes or beach-inspired motifs.
Practical Solutions
Consider using tiebacks to easily pull your curtains aside during peak sunlight hours. This not only showcases your beautiful view but also keeps your indoor space cooler. If you live in a particularly hot climate, thermal lining on your draperies can help regulate temperature without compromising style.
Fall: Cozy Warmth and Earthy Tones
With the arrival of fall comes a craving for warmth and coziness. It’s time to transition into richer colors and heavier fabrics that mimic the changing leaves outside.
Fabric Choices
Choose heavier materials such as velvet or warm-toned cotton blends that add texture and warmth to your interiors. These fabrics are perfect for insulating windows as temperatures drop.
Color Palette
Fall’s color palette is rich with burnt oranges, deep reds, mustard yellows, and earthy browns. Consider solid-colored drapes or those with subtle leaf patterns that resonate with the outdoor scenery.
Layering and Textures
Play with textures by incorporating chunky knit throws over window seats or adding decorative pillows that pick up on your drapery colors. Layering different fabric weights can also create an inviting atmosphere; for instance, pair heavier drapes with lighter sheers underneath for added depth.
Winter: A Touch of Elegance and Warmth
Winter often brings a sense of calmness and stillness. It’s an opportunity to create a cozy sanctuary where you can unwind from the chill outside.
Fabric Choices
Draperies made from heavy fabrics like brocade or lined velvet work wonders for insulation while adding an air of sophistication. The richness of these materials enhances the overall elegance of a room.
Color Palette
Opt for deep jewel tones like emerald greens, sapphire blues, or rich burgundy paired with metallic accents like gold or silver to reflect winter festivities. You might even consider snowflake patterns or subtle shimmering details for added whimsy during the holiday season.
Window Treatments for Cozy Vibes
Use floor-length drapes to create an enveloping effect; they not only add warmth but also bring an element of grandeur to any room. Add a touch of festivity by incorporating decorative elements such as ribbon tiebacks or holiday-themed curtain clips that can be easily removed after the festive season.
Year-Round Tips for Seasonal Drapery Updates
Even though you may choose specific themes based on seasons, there are several evergreen tips that apply throughout the year:
Store Wisely
When storing off-season drapery, make sure they are clean before putting them away. Use breathable garment bags to prevent dust accumulation and keep them looking fresh when you’re ready to switch them out again.
Accessorize Smartly
Decorative elements such as curtain rods and finials can also change the look of your room dramatically without needing an entire overhaul. Opting for stylish rod styles in various finishes—like brushed nickel or antique bronze—can enhance the overall aesthetic without much effort.
Consider Functionality
In addition to aesthetics, ensure your drapes serve their purpose effectively throughout all seasons. Light-filtering options allow you to enjoy natural light while maintaining privacy; blackout liners can help maintain indoor temperatures during extreme weather changes.
DIY Projects
For those who enjoy crafting, consider making seasonal window accents yourself! Whether it’s stenciling leaves on burlap for fall or sewing cotton panels decorated with summer patterns, personalized touches will imbue every season with love and creativity.
